Function of Cable Management in Fire Detection Systems
Fire detection systems depend on continuous signal paths and stable cable routes. Accessories such as mounting clips and cable ties ensure structural integrity under conditions involving heat, vibration, or scheduled maintenance.
Effective cable support prevents strain on terminations and lowers the chance of faults that could go unnoticed until inspection.
Organised cable routing also assists engineers with future inspections and upgrades without disrupting existing pathways.

Why Clips Matter in Fire System Installations
Cable clips minimise cable sag and restrict movement, especially where cables run along ceilings, walls, or containment systems exposed to environmental changes.
When properly chosen, these clips retain the cable in position even during minor structural shifts or vibration.
Fire-rated clips help in maintaining cable position during a fire event, preserving system operation for as long as possible.
Neatly fixed cables form predictable paths, making identification and maintenance tasks easier. This improves engineer efficiency and helps ensure adherence during audits.
Fastening Ties and Their Value in Fire Detection Systems
Cable ties group fire system wiring efficiently. If appropriately applied, they provide strong support without damaging the cable insulation.
The balance between tightness and pressure is vital for long-term system stability.
Nylon ties work well in internal settings, whereas stainless steel or chemical-resistant options perform better in outdoor or harsh environments.

Buying Considerations for Cable Clips and Ties
All accessories should comply with relevant fire safety standards and local regulations.
Always review test certifications, material data, and product guarantees before procurement.
Environmental factors such as moisture, dust, and temperature will affect the material performance differently.
Sourcing from a established supplier ensures consistency and avoids the risks associated with mixed product quality.
Establishing a consistent specification standard across the installation protects system integrity.
